So which school is the best?  You know what....I dont know.  There are kids that have left EIC which was said to be the best for UK Education to go to Swans.  There are kids that have left Swans this year to go to Mayfair, Aloha or EIC.  Kids from Laude moved to Swans.

Schools are a  really personal choice and for me, whilst my daughters happy, Im happy.  Yes I still have a moan, I think there is a major lack of communication and it does feel its money money money.  Its a business at the end of the day.

But every school has its positives and negatives and everyone has a moan and unhappy at some point.

If you are choosing a school, go see them, hang around in the morning and in the afternoon, see if you like the atmosphere.Check exam results and most important how do you feel when you walk in that school!
